Pulsatile Innovations, headquartered in Drouin, Australia, is an innovative medtech entity focused on developing solutions for critical emergency healthcare scenarios. Founded by Elleesha King, an experienced ambulance paramedic and registered nurse, the company emerged from a direct clinical need identified through years of frontline healthcare experience. King observed the significant difficulties and anxieties healthcare professionals faced in manually detecting a pulse during suspected cardiac arrest, often leading to delays in crucial life-saving interventions. This firsthand insight spurred the development of their flagship product, the Pulse Tile. Elleesha King's extensive clinical background as an ambulance paramedic and registered nurse directly informed the creation of Pulse Tile.
The Pulse Tile is designed as a single-use, intuitive medical device that provides rapid and accurate feedback on pulse presence and CPR compression quality. Its primary function is to eliminate the subjectivity of manual pulse checks, offering a clear "CPR/No CPR" indication to rescuers, regardless of their medical background. This innovative approach aims to dramatically reduce the critical assessment time, which current guidelines suggest should be under 10 seconds, but often takes much longer even for highly trained professionals. By providing objective data, the Pulse Tile seeks to enable faster, more confident decision-making, thereby improving patient outcomes and reducing unnecessary CPR. The device is intended to streamline emergency cardiac care by offering clear, real-time guidance to responders.
Pulsatile Innovations has made significant strides since its inception. The company received its first prototype in June 2024 and has been actively developing its minimum viable product. Demonstrating a strong commitment to intellectual property, Pulsatile Innovations has lodged a provisional patent and submitted a PCT patent application, providing protection across 158 countries. The company is currently preparing for a pre-seed funding round of $850,000 to finalise its product, gather clinical data for validation, and strengthen its regulatory strategies. The securing of intellectual property, including a PCT patent application covering 158 countries, highlights the company's forward-thinking strategy.
Leadership at Pulsatile Innovations is spearheaded by founder and CEO Elleesha King. She is supported by a dedicated team, including Rayna Berg as Chief of Operations, Professor Paul Stoddart as Chief Technology Officer, and Nicolette Muller as Quality and Regulatory Lead. This diverse team combines expertise in public health, biomedical engineering, and regulatory affairs, augmented by an advisory board. Pulsatile Innovations has also gained recognition through its participation in competitive programs such as the Australian Clinical Entrepreneur Program (AUSCEP) and Swinburne University's Initiative and Elevate Program. The company's work has also been featured on national platforms like 7NEWS Australia. Pulsatile Innovations is driven by a profound mission to enhance global survival rates for cardiac arrest victims.
